4-Metre Monster Swells Slam Mauritius, No Beach Day Today
4-Metre Monster Swells Slam Mauritius, No Beach Day Today

Severe Swell Alert. Sun, 28th January 2024. A severe swell alert has been issued for Mauritius on Sunday 28th January 2024 at 10:00, and will be valid until Monday 29th January 2024 at 04:00.

The warning for heavy swells remains in place for Mauritius, with swells reaching up to 4 metres causing rough to very rough seas beyond the reefs.

Reports show wave heights of approximately 4 metres in the southern part of the island on Saturday 27th January 2024.

These intense swells may result in waves breaking on the beaches during high tides.

As a result, fishermen, pleasure-craft users and the general public are strongly advised to avoid venturing out to sea and staying away from the beaches during high tides.

It is anticipated that the heavy swells will gradually subside starting from tonight.

Source: Mauritius Meteorological Services
